An election judge in Hubbard County, Minnesota, faces serious charges for allowing 11 unregistered voters to cast ballots without completing the necessary registration paperwork on election day. While voters can register on the same day, the judge failed to follow the required process. As a result, the judge is now charged with two felonies, which carry a maximum penalty of 10 years in prison and fines up to $20,000.

Some states are allowing votes to be received and counted after election day, which contradicts federal law that designates the first Tuesday after the first Monday in November as election day. This practice raises concerns about potential fraud and undermines voter confidence. Judicial Watch is currently suing Illinois and Mississippi for permitting ballots to be counted days or weeks after election day, as long as they are dated on or before that day. Judicial Watch is committed to ensuring fair and honest elections and is prepared to take necessary actions to uphold the law.
